I am using an STEVAL-IDB008V2 board which contains a BlueNRG-2 chip. I am testing out this product using Keil uVision (version 5.29.0.0), and I am running the BlueNRG-2 sensor demo code (with sleep function removed; I learned this causes problems).

To debug, I have the board connected via ST-LINK/V2 with the latest firmware.

When I try to run debug, I can only connect to the device after retrying many times. I usually get the following error messages:

  • No target connected.
  • Error: Target DLL has been cancelled. Debugger aborted!
  • Cannot access target.

I noticed that the DL4 LED is usually off when I have trouble connecting to the device, and it is usually ON when I can connect successfully. Shouldn't the ST-LINK provide sufficient power for debugging?
